We hosted a surprise birthday party for my fiancé at the Rec Hall's private room and it was a perfect space! The room was huge and even had its own outdoor portion for guests to use as well which we did not know about at first! The private room had ample table space for setting up food and tables/chairs/couches for guests to lounge and eat at along with its own private games as well. We really enjoyed using the two tvs to display a photo slideshow and a big bluetooth speaker to play music which were all provided already in the booking package. In addition to the private room being a great space for everyone, what really impressed my guests and I were how attentive and friendly the staff were! They attended to the guests for drinks constantly and helped us with setting up for the event as well as answering any questions we had at the time. They all provided great customer service and were always quick to help when we wanted to order more pizza for example. Everyone had a great time and we will all definitely be back!

This place was not very obvious from the outside, very dark and unilluminated, maybe a temporary issue. But the inside was yard game/dive bar heaven. Like the Armory or Westport Social but home made like your neighbor's Cornhole boxes and garage man cave. Big open space. Ping pong, bags/c-hole, beer pong, Plinko, GIANT Connect Four, GIANT Battleship, "giant" Jenga, Bocce, and ”Airbowling” - which looked like beer pong played with volleyballs and trash cans. Some parts of the roof were leaking and the concrete floors were like ice in spots with puddles, but I'll be back and probably reserve the private back room. Oh, the pizza was legit fantastic - home made wood fired New York style.Vegetarian options: Wood fired homemade cheese pizza, cheesy pizza bread
